After eight years, Katharine
Buckley McNamara ’81, the first woman to direct the
College’s Office of Public Affairs, has left the position
to become the vice president of the Close Up Foundation in
Alexandria, Va. McNamara will lead the foundation’s
marketing division. Close Up is the nation’s largest
nonprofit citizenship education organization.
Under McNamara’s leadership, the scope of the public
affairs mission at Holy Cross was expanded—new technology
was implemented to increase the national visibility of the
College and to communicate the Holy Cross mission more effectively
and extensively. She led the effort to upgrade the tabloid-style
periodical Crossroads to the current full-color Holy
Cross Magazine. In addition, McNamara oversaw the creation of the
College’s first Web site and directed the Admissions
marketing study and the redesign of Admissions materials.
“Kathy has handled her role as the College’s primary
spokesperson with grace, professionalism and skill,” says
Rev. Michael C. McFarland, S.J., president of the College. “She
has helped to get out the good news about Holy Cross through
an ever-expanding variety of media outlets. We wish Kathy
and her family well, but we will miss her very much.”
